What ChatGPT Can (and Can’t) Do for Your Listings

Before diving into prompts, let’s set expectations.

ChatGPT excels at:

  • Drafting keyword-rich titles that follow Amazon’s formatting rules
  • Writing benefit-focused bullet points in A9-friendly structures
  • Generating A+ content copy at scale
  • Brainstorming backend keyword lists from seed terms
  • Reformatting existing copy to improve readability and keyword density

ChatGPT needs help with:

  • Real-time keyword search volume data (you need Helium 10 or Brand Analytics for that)
  • Understanding your specific product’s exact differentiators (you must tell it)
  • Amazon policy compliance (always review outputs against current Amazon guidelines)
  • Conversion rate prediction (AI writes copy; your data tells you what converts)

The key insight: ChatGPT is a drafting engine, not a strategy engine. You provide the strategy (keywords, positioning, audience), and ChatGPT produces the copy at speed.

How to Write Amazon Titles with ChatGPT

Amazon titles are the highest-impact element of your listing. They carry the most keyword weight with the A9 algorithm and are the first thing shoppers see in search results.

The Prompt Template

Act as an expert Amazon copywriter. Write 3 product title variations for the following product:

Product: [product name]
Key features: [feature 1], [feature 2], [feature 3]
Primary keyword: [your #1 keyword]
Secondary keywords: [keyword 2], [keyword 3], [keyword 4]
Target audience: [who buys this]
Character limit: 200 characters (Amazon maximum)
Category: [Amazon category]

Rules:
- Lead with the primary keyword
- Include brand name near the beginning
- Use pipe "|" or comma "," separators between feature callouts
- Avoid promotional language ("best," "amazing," "#1")
- Do NOT use all caps
- Focus on features and use cases, not emotions

Real Example Output (Travel Tumbler)

Title Option 1:
BrandName 20oz Travel Tumbler, Vacuum Insulated Stainless Steel Coffee Mug | Leak-Proof Lid | Keeps Drinks Cold 24 Hours, Hot 12 Hours

Title Option 2:
BrandName Stainless Steel Tumbler 20 oz | Double Wall Vacuum Insulated Travel Mug | Leak-Proof | Hot & Cold Coffee Thermos

Title Option 3:
BrandName 20 Oz Insulated Tumbler to Stainless Steel Travel Coffee Mug, Keeps Drinks Cold 24hr, Leak-Proof Lid, BPA-Free

💡 Pro tip: Always run your final title through Helium 10’s Listing Analyzer or Amazon’s own search preview to confirm keyword indexing before going live.

How to Write Bullet Points with ChatGPT

Amazon allows 5 bullet points per listing (up to 500 characters each). The most effective structure leads with a BENEFIT in all caps, followed by the feature that delivers it, and includes a relevant keyword naturally.

The Prompt Template

Act as an Amazon listing specialist. Write 5 bullet points for the product below.

Product: [product name]
Key features: [list all main features]
Primary keyword: [main keyword]
Secondary keywords: [keyword 2], [keyword 3], [keyword 4], [keyword 5]
Target customer: [describe your buyer]
Main pain points solved: [pain point 1], [pain point 2], [pain point 3]

Format each bullet as:
[BENEFIT IN CAPS] to [Feature explanation + keyword, 2-3 sentences]

Focus on benefits to the buyer, not just specs. Include a keyword in at least 3 of the 5 bullets.

Real Example Output (Posture Corrector)

ELIMINATE BACK PAIN ALL DAY to Our posture corrector for women and men gently realigns your spine during work or exercise. Clinically designed brace reduces muscle fatigue within the first week of daily use.

INVISIBLE UNDER CLOTHING to Ultra-thin, lightweight posture brace fits discreetly under shirts, blouses, or workwear. No bulky straps or visible outlines, wear it confidently anywhere.

ADJUSTABLE FOR EVERY BODY to One-size fits all design with dual adjustment straps fits chest sizes 28″ to 48″. Works for both men and women with chronic upper back, neck, or shoulder tension.

MEDICAL-GRADE COMFORT to Soft neoprene material is breathable and skin-safe for extended wear. Unlike rigid posture supports, our flexible design moves with you, not against you.

RESULTS IN 2 WEEKS OR YOUR MONEY BACK to Thousands of verified buyers report measurable improvement in posture and reduced neck tension after 14 days of consistent use. Backed by a 60-day satisfaction guarantee.

How to Write A+ Content with ChatGPT

A+ Content (Enhanced Brand Content for Brand Registered sellers) is your chance to tell a deeper brand story with images and text modules. ChatGPT can draft the copy blocks efficiently.

The Prompt Template

Act as a brand copywriter specializing in Amazon A+ Content. Write copy for the following A+ content modules:

Product: [product name]
Brand story: [1-2 sentences about your brand's mission or founding story]
Key differentiators vs. competition: [differentiator 1], [differentiator 2], [differentiator 3]
Target audience: [describe buyer persona]
Tone: [professional / friendly / aspirational / scientific]

Write copy for:
1. Hero banner headline (max 75 characters) + subheadline (max 150 characters)
2. Feature module 1: [Feature name] to headline + 2-3 sentences of body copy
3. Feature module 2: [Feature name] to headline + 2-3 sentences
4. Feature module 3: [Feature name] to headline + 2-3 sentences
5. Brand story module to 75-100 words
6. Comparison table: Our product vs. typical competitor, 4 differentiating features

💡 Pro tip: A+ Content does NOT directly affect keyword indexing, but it significantly improves conversion rate. Use ChatGPT here to maximize persuasion, not keyword stuffing.

How to Generate Backend Keywords with ChatGPT

Backend keywords are the hidden keyword fields in Seller Central that help Amazon index your listing for searches that don’t appear in your visible copy. You have 250 bytes to work with.

The Prompt Template

Act as an Amazon SEO specialist. Generate a backend keyword list for the product below.

Product: [product name and description]
Target market: [US / UK / other]
Main use cases: [use case 1], [use case 2], [use case 3]
Keywords already in my title and bullets (do NOT repeat): [paste your title + bullets]
Competitor keywords to capture: [optional]

Rules:
- No duplicate words already in title or bullets
- No competitor brand names (Amazon policy violation)
- Output as a single space-separated string, max 250 bytes
- Include synonyms, misspellings, and alternate phrasings

What ChatGPT gives you: a solid starting draft. What you add: Run your seed keywords through Helium 10 Cerebro or Amazon Brand Analytics to identify high-volume terms ChatGPT missed, then fold those in.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Sellers using AI for listings often fall into predictable traps:

  1. Keyword stuffing instead of keyword weaving, ChatGPT will sometimes cram keywords unnaturally. Review every output and ensure keywords flow naturally in sentences.
  2. Skipping the keyword research step, ChatGPT doesn’t know which keywords have 50,000 monthly searches vs. 50. Always pre-research with Helium 10, Brand Analytics, or Jungle Scout before prompting.
  3. Using generic prompts, The less specific your prompt, the more generic the output. Include your exact product features, competitor differentiators, and target customer in every prompt.
  4. Forgetting Amazon policy review, AI-generated copy can accidentally include prohibited claims. Run all copy through Amazon’s listing quality check.
  5. Publishing the first draft, ChatGPT’s first output is a starting point. Edit for brand voice, accuracy, and conversion before publishing.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can ChatGPT write Amazon listings on its own?

ChatGPT can draft strong listing copy, but it needs your inputs: your keywords, product features, target audience, and brand voice. Without these specifics, the output will be generic. Think of ChatGPT as a fast drafting partner, not a replacement for your strategy.

Does AI-written Amazon copy perform as well as human-written?

When given strong inputs and edited properly, AI-generated listings can match or outperform manually written copy. The key is using real keyword data (from Helium 10, Brand Analytics, etc.) and editing the draft to match your brand voice before publishing.

Will Amazon penalize AI-generated listings?

As of 2026, Amazon does not penalize listings for being AI-generated. They evaluate listings on quality, relevance, and compliance, not on how they were written. Just ensure the copy meets Amazon’s content policies and doesn’t make prohibited claims.

How do I get better results from ChatGPT for Amazon?

Be specific. Include your top 5 to 10 keywords, all key product features, your target buyer’s main pain points, and your desired tone. The more context you give ChatGPT, the better and more targeted the output.

What’s the best ChatGPT model to use for Amazon listing copy?

GPT-4o (the default in ChatGPT Plus) produces the most natural, high-quality listing copy. For batch work across many SKUs, the API with GPT-4o is the most cost-effective approach.
